Quick question for Draco or anyone else who might know. I noticed in Draco's amazing Enter the Dragon theme he included an RRS feed ( at least I think that is what it is) I was wondering if it's possible to include this feature in some other themes such as Bluebox via theme editor?
#445
Posted 01 July 2011 - 10:54 PM
It is. I use it for BlueBox myself. You need to go into the theme editor and lay it out (I put it under the game list myself, you can shorten the length of the game list and put the RSS box under it). Then you save your theme. You can also put the weather on it using the same placement method. I put thaxt above BlueBox's version number and it looks great.
All this is easy to do in the theme editor. To add your text and/or RSS feed you just select the 2nd tab in Theme Editor (it's either options or tools, I can't remember offhand),select scroller, select the page you want from the list on the right, and paste what you want in the box to the left. Make sure you save the text after each page.
If you want to post the theme.ini on the main board I can do the cosmetics for you pretty easy.

You are correct. In Theme Editor, you can add the RSS feed through the Scroller option. From there you will be presented with the GameEx areas and emulators so that you can tailor the feed to the screen (i.e. MameDev RSS feed for MAME Screens, Nintendo RSS feeds for Nintendo screens, GameEx RSS feed for Start screen, etc.). I believe that this feature is only available for themes > Version 1 so if the theme is a default theme, it may need to be up-converted to a newer version and saved as a separate theme. I think there is also a utility on the GameEx.com site that will also convert themes without having to load in Theme Editor, however, I have never used it.
